Matthew Pomainville September 5, 1995 to November 6, 2021
Family and friends are so sad to announce that Matthew has lost his battle against addiction. Many rehab centers alone with all the Love and help from family and friends often times just aren’t enough. Matthew was known for his kind heart and silly attitude. A son, grandson, nephew, cousin and friend. He was a jokester who enjoyed softball, fishing, four wheeling, and hunting. Whether the driver or passenger, Matt also loved driving fast. When entering several rehabilitation facilities he was always lending a hand and tried to help anyone in the program even though he was struggling himself. He was becoming the beam of light and inspiration for many trying to stay clean, He became a lost soul after the unexpected passing of his mother Diane in 2012. Matt never truly mourned his Mom, always searching for a way to relieve his pain. He always put on a brave face although he was crushed and falling apart deep down. Stuck in a vicious downward spiral, we all witnesses and couldn’t change. Matthew is no longer fighting his demons or in pain. He will be dearly missed by many.
